What is Human-in-the-Loop?

Skill Level:

Human-in-the-loop refers to a collaborative approach where humans and AI systems work together to achieve optimal results. It involves combining human expertise, judgement, and intervention with AI capabilities. By incorporating human feedback, AI models can learn and adapt, ensuring accuracy, fairness, and ethical decision-making.
